#4d8e83 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d8e83 is composed of 30.2% red, 55.7%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.7%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 169.8 degrees, a saturation of 29.7% and a lightness of 42.9%. #4d8e83 color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#001d07.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#4d8e83 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4d8e83 has RGB values of R:77, G:142,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 5082755.

Shades and Tints of #4d8e83
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f4f9f8 is the lightest one.
